To all my supporters – I did it! By Lenny Chesel, CMO and VP of Strategic Sales, Host.net. President of South Florida Technology Alliance
When I ran out of steam and my legs were cramping so badly my fellow riders thought I couldn’t or shouldn’t go on…. I thought about how you all supported me to ride my bicycle and not a van to Key West. This was an experience beyond anything I could imagine – a sense of accomplishment never before experienced. Upon arriving on the actual island of Key West a feeling came over me I can’t really describe. When we rode through the streets of Key West and the crowd cheered us on it was amazing. I raised $2,200 thanks to you – but equally as important, I persevered because of your support and encouragement – thank you very much!!!
